Sage Laurel's monthly cost for a private room is set at $4,500, which reflects a premium compared to the average rates in Maricopa County and throughout Arizona. In comparison, the cost of a private room in Maricopa County averages around $3,318, while the statewide average stands slightly higher at $3,345. This discrepancy indicates that Sage Laurel may offer enhanced services or amenities that justify its elevated pricing. Potential residents and their families should consider these factors when evaluating options within the local market.

Sage Laurel in Glendale, AZ is a warm and inviting assisted living community that provides board and care home services as well as respite care. Our dedicated staff is committed to providing personalized care and support to our residents while ensuring their safety and comfort.
Our community boasts a variety of amenities designed to enhance the lives of our residents. We have a spacious dining room where nutritious meals are served three times a day, accommodating any special dietary restrictions. Our fully furnished accommodations provide a cozy and familiar atmosphere for our residents. The well-maintained garden and outdoor space offer opportunities for relaxation and enjoying nature.
Additionally, we take pride in keeping our community clean and orderly with the help of our housekeeping services. We offer move-in coordination assistance to make the transition into our community as seamless as possible. Residents can stay connected with friends and family through telephone service and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access.
At Sage Laurel, we understand the importance of comprehensive care services. Our trained caregivers provide ass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ers, ensuring that each resident's needs are met with dignity and respect. We also coordinate with health care providers to ensure continuity of care. Our staff is experienced in diabetes management, offering specialized diets for residents who require it.
Residents can participate in scheduled daily activities to engage their minds and bodies. Whether it's socializing with other residents or pursuing individual hobbies, there are ample opportunities for meaningful engagement within our community.
For added convenience, there are numerous amenities available nearby. With 9 cafes, 5 parks, 19 pharmacies, 17 physicians' offices, 20 restaurants, and 3 places of worship all within close proximity, residents have easy access to various services they may need.
At Sage Laurel in Glendale, AZ, we strive to provide a nurturing environment where residents can live comfortably while receiving personalized care tailored to their unique needs.
Located in Glendale, Arizona, this neighborhood offers a variety of amenities within close proximity. For dining options, there are several fast food chains such as Sonic Drive-In, Chick-Fil-A, and Chipotle Mexican Grill nearby. Additionally, there are pharmacies like Walgreens and CVS Pharmacy for convenient healthcare access. For medical needs, there are reputable facilities like Banner Thunderbird Surgery Center and Arrowhead Health Centers within a few miles. If you enjoy outdoor activities, there are multiple parks in the area including Conocido Park and Foothills Park. For entertainment, theaters like AMC Arrowhead 14 and Arrowhead Fountains 18 offer movie options. With places of worship like Pure Heart Christian Fellowship available as well, this neighborhood provides a mix of conveniences for seniors looking to settle down in a vibrant community.

An Extensive Exploration of the VA Aid and Attendance Benefit
The VA Aid and Attendance benefit provides financial support to veterans needing assistance with daily living due to medical conditions or disabilities, augmenting standard VA pensions for services like in-home care. Eligibility is based on service duration, wartime status, income, and medical needs, with a detailed application process required to access funds for caregiving and home modifications.
Senior Transition Services: Understanding Their Role, Cost, and Importance
Senior move management services assist older adults in the relocation process by providing emotional support and organizational help, addressing unique challenges like downsizing and moving from long-term homes. These specialists collaborate with real estate agents and manage logistics, making the transition smoother for seniors and their families.
